Cursusaanbod

Inleiding

  • Het belang van een DC/OS (Distributed Cloud Operating System)
  • Resource sharing
  • Data sharing
  • Programmeerabstractering
  • Foutopsporing en bewaking

DC/OS kernel components

  • Masters en agents

DC/OS user space components

  • Systeemcomponents
    • Admin Router, een interne load balancer
    • Cosmos, een interne packaging API service
    • Exhibitor, een Java supervisiesysteem voor ZooKeeper
    • Marathon, een Apache Mesos framework voor container orchestration
    • Mesos-DNS, een interne DNS service

Installatie en beheer van DC/OS

  • Werken met DC/OS components en services
  • Werken met de CLI
  • Load balancing met Marathon

Installatie van gedistribueerde systemen (toepassingen) met DC/OS Universe

  • HDFS
  • Apache Spark
  • Apache Kafka
  • Apache Cassandra
  • Jenkins

Deploying toepassingen in Docker containers

Deploying toepassingen in native Mesos containers (met Linux cgroups en namespaces)

Gebruik van Marathon voor native container orchestration

Zorgen voor hoge beschikbaarheid en fouttolerantie voor toepassingen en services

Gebruik maken van het GUI-gebaseerde monitoring en management systeem

Scheduling systemen zoals Kubernetes en Swarm als services

Resource management en abstractie

Ontdekken van andere ready-to-install pakketten

  • ArangoDB, Avi Networks, Cassandra, Chronos, Confluent, Crate, DataDog, Elasticsearch, Etcd, Exhibitor, HDFS, Hue, Jenkins, Kafka, Linkerd, Marathon-lb, Marathon, MemSQL, mr-redis, Namerd, NGINIX, OpenVPN, Project Calico, Quobyte, Riak, Ruxit, Spark, Spark Notebook, Storm, Swarm, Weave en Zeppelin

Andere DC/OS installatieopties

  • Bare metal installations vs virtuele machines en cloudinstallaties

Samenvatting en conclusie

Vereisten

  • Systeembeheerders
  • DevOps ingenieurs
 14 Uren

Aantal deelnemers


Prijs Per Deelnemer

Getuigenissen (5)

Voorlopige Aankomende Cursussen

Gerelateerde categorieën